2026 Orrin Star Scholar Rita Perloff!

Congratulations goes to Rita Perloff who is the recipient of the 2026 Orrin Star Music Scholarship. Rita is a 14 year old from Oxford, Pennsylvania. Rita has been playing guitar in the band, Full Steam. Rita attends many festivals and Kids Academies. You can often see Rita and her fellow students busking around the festival grounds. With only 2 1/2 years of lessons, Rita is already playing solos! With her scholarship, Rita will attend the DelFest Music Academy.

The Orrin Star Scholarship honors the memory and generosity of a remarkable man, who lived in the DC area for most of his career and who was a friend to many in the bluegrass community. Orrin gained notoriety as a champion flat-picker and went on to enrich many of our lives with the warmth and humor of his performing and teaching.

One important aspect of DCBU’s mission is to promote music education. We offer an instructor directory so students can locate teachers in their local area for in-person instruction. Additionally, since so many great musicians teach online classes, we’re now posting information for instructors wherever they are located.
